The zeolitic tuff (Zlatokop deposit, Vranjska Banja, Serbia) containing 70% of clinoptilolite was used as a manure additive in this work. Clinoptilolite as a binding agent can be “carrier” of ammonia ion. In the present study, cattle manure enriched with clinoptilolite was applied as an organomineral fertilizer. The experiment was carried out on a natural pasture in period 2012-14 in Western Serbia. It included five different treatments: a) control without fertilizer; b) pure fermented cattle manure (30 t ha-1); c) organomineral fertilizer (30 t ha-1 cattle manure +10 wt.% zeolite); d) pure zeolite (3 t ha-1); and e) nitrogen application by mineral fertilizer, 50 kg ha-1 N in the first year and 30 kg ha-1 N in the second year. The fertilizers were applied in autumn, except mineral fertilizer which was applied in spring. The dry matter (DM) contents and the botanical compositions of forage were estimated for two years. Treatments with manure, organomineral fertilizer and mineral N appli...cation gave higher DM yield compared to control plots, and changes have been reflected on pasture composition, which affected forage quality.
